China News Service, Nanchang, March 1 (Reporter Liu Zhankun and Wu Pengquan) The Jiangxi Provincial Meteorological Bureau announced on the evening of March 1 that at 15:19 that day, the B-10GD aircraft of Beidahuang General Airlines was performing an artificial precipitation mission. In the process, it fell into the territory of Ji'an County, Ji'an City, the province, causing a fire in a private house, killing all 5 people on board.

  After receiving the report, Jiangxi officials demanded to do their best to search and rescue. The main responsible persons of the emergency, meteorological and civil aviation supervision departments of the province rushed to the scene, and organized emergency, fire, public security and other forces to quickly carry out rescue.

  According to officials, as of now, the open flames on the scene have been extinguished, three houses have been damaged, and one villager suffered minor injuries and has been sent to a doctor. It has been confirmed that all five people on board have been killed.

  The cause of the accident is being checked, and the aftermath is being dealt with in an orderly manner.
